The Importance of Bankroll Management
Effective bankroll management is arguably the most critical aspect of successful gaming. Regardless of the strategy employed, a well-defined bankroll management plan is essential for preserving capital and mitigating the risk of significant losses. This involves setting clear limits on the amount of money one is willing to wager, and adhering to those limits regardless of winning or losing streaks. A common rule of thumb is to never wager more than a small percentage of one’s bankroll on a single game or event. Determining the appropriate percentage will depend on the player’s risk tolerance and the volatility of the game. Disciplined bankroll management not only protects against financial ruin but also promotes responsible gaming habits.
- Set a strict budget and adhere to it.
- Divide your bankroll into smaller units.
- Never chase losses.
- Understand the concept of variance.
- Regularly review and adjust your bankroll management plan.
Implementing these strategies will provide a solid foundation for sustainable participation and minimize the potential for emotional decision-making, a common pitfall among even experienced players.
Identifying and Mitigating Potential Risks
While strategic gaming can offer significant benefits, it’s essential to be aware of the potential risks involved. One of the primary risks is the inherent unpredictability of games based on chance. Even with a sophisticated strategy and a thorough understanding of game mechanics, there is always the possibility of experiencing losing streaks. Another risk is the potential for psychological biases to cloud judgment. Players may fall victim to the gambler’s fallacy, believing that past outcomes influence future events, or the confirmation bias, selectively focusing on information that confirms their existing beliefs. Furthermore, the ever-changing nature of online gaming platforms necessitates constant vigilance. Game developers frequently update their algorithms and mechanics, potentially invalidating previously effective strategies.
Protecting Against Scams and Unfair Practices
The online gaming world is unfortunately not immune to scams and unfair practices. Players should exercise caution when choosing gaming platforms and be wary of offers that seem too good to be true. It’s important to thoroughly research a platform’s reputation, read reviews from other players, and verify its licensing and regulatory status. Protecting personal information is also paramount. Players should use strong, unique passwords and avoid sharing their login credentials with anyone. Be cautious about clicking on suspicious links or downloading software from untrusted sources. Reporting any suspected fraudulent activity to the relevant authorities is essential for maintaining a safe and secure gaming environment.
- Verify the platform's licensing and regulation.
- Read reviews and check the platform's reputation.
- Use strong, unique passwords.
- Be cautious of offers that seem too good to be true.
- Report any suspicious activity.
Proactive measures and a healthy dose of skepticism are essential for protecting oneself against potential scams and ensuring a fair and enjoyable gaming experience.
